Don't get me wrong, this is some absolute BS from MSoft, but no it's not accurate to say you can't use whatever default browser you want. It's that there are a very few select things that force you into opening a link in edge - as far as I'm aware this is functionality mostly limited to just websearch from the start menu. So if you prefer to Google/DuckDuckGo your shit by first opening a browser, this won't really affect you. It's important philosophically and as an indicator of Msoft's behaviour/strategy, but doesn't considerably affect users too much.

Caveat - I haven't used Windows 11 so I'm unaware if they've enhanced the number of places that these edge specific links are used. In windows 10 I haven't even bothered to implement some workaround because I never want to search the web from my start menu
